Full job description
Shift: 10:00 PM-8:00 AM
Hourly Rate: $26.39 an hour
Job Summary
The Operator Mechanic reports to the Maintenance Supervisor and is responsible for a variety of responsibilities including ensuring assigned equipment is ready for startup/changeovers. Visually inspect equipment to ensure operation according to standards making adjustments. Complete centerline inspections and may assist mechanics with minor repairs, replacements, and modifications to equipment following all safety regulations and ensuring all GMP and quality standards are met. Must have own hand tools. Starting pay up to $26.39 per hour + Attendance Bonus! ($0.50 for first shift, $0.60 for second shift, and $0.70 for third shift). You will be onsite at the Conagra manufacturing facility.
Essential Job Functions
- Ability to work the scheduled/assigned times and required overtime for position
- Regular attendance to ensure production requirements are met
- Ability to read, write, communicate, and comprehend written instructions in English
- Ability to complete work/purchase requests into the maintenance tracking and performance computer system
- Knowledge of planned maintenance
- Knowledge of basic hand tools
- Basic math skills
- Good safety record and complete all necessary training.
- Ability to lift up to 75 lbs.
You Will
- Verify product for startup
- Ensure equipment is ready for startup/changeovers performing pre-start checks
- Visually inspect equipment to ensure it is operating according to standards making adjustments
- Complete centerline inspections to identify defects
- Grease seals and bearings, clean, inspect, and replace belts
- Assist mechanics with minor repairs, replacements, and modifications to equipment
- Assist mechanics with Planned Maintenance (PM)
- Teardown equipment for changeover/sanitation
- Complete daily paperwork (e.g., centerline reports, scale audits, PM/AM sheets)
- Keep work area free from debris to maintain a safe and efficient production process
- Participate in production line drumbeats
- General housekeeping (e.g., sweeping, wiping down guards, removal of contaminants, etc.)
You Have
- Knowledge of GMP’s
- Ability to be LOTO certified
Qualifications
Education: High school diploma or GED.
Experience Required: Minimum 1 year maintenance or related experience.
Anticipated Close Date: September 4, 2026
Location: Council Bluffs, Iowa
